more sea swept

I have been making 7- 10 sea swept blocks every Friday with my quilt group. I have collected a nice size pile. I thought I would take an accounting and decide where to go from here. I was pleasantly surprised to realize I have 38 made. and 7 in process with 2 rounds. I need 42. This pattern calls for a sashing that will make a wonderful star. The pattern is also for paperpiecing. And the finished piece is smaller than what I am doing. SO, I will need to "invent" what I will need for my block. I think it is time for some paper doodles and math before I can go on with the project.


I obviously miscounted the cutting. I still have a lot of pieces left over. Do I make it bigger? and maybe skip the sashing? Decisions and decisions


pattern

Do I wish that I had not pieced my own block so that I could just follow the pattern? Nope, I prefer piecing over paper piecing any day. And I love the blocks I am making.
